pinwheel craft for kids(create-kids-crafts.com) Pinwheel

Craft Supplies needed:

paper
Scissors
pencil
ruler
long plastic straw or dowling stick 1 1/2 feet long
bead
pin with large head

Cut a square of paper. Draw lines using a ruler, from corner to corner. Cut halfway along each line. Fold alternate corners into the middle. Overlap the points. Pin them to the straw or stick, with the bead behind them. This will help the pinwheel spin. Younger preschool kids will need more help with this craft.




spring crafts for kids(create kids crafts) Flower Button Jar

This may be used to hold any number of small items.

Supplies needed:

baby food jar
flat buttons
paint or window markers
paintbrush
quick setting glue

Glue several buttons on the outside of the jar to represent flowers. Hold the buttons in place until the glue is set. Paint stems and leaves on to the jar for the flowers. Add any other decorations you may want.

rainbow streamer(spring crafts for kids) Rainbow Streamers

Supplies needed:

Large paper plate
markers or crayons
5 or 6 different colored streamers
scissors
tape

Cut paper plate in half and then cut off the rim of the plate. Color arches on the plate to resemble a rainbow. Tape 12 inch lengths of different colored streamers to the cut side of the plate. Take the rainbows outside and let the colors blow in the wind. Kids also love to dance to music with these.







spring crafts for kids April Showers

Craft Supplies needed:

Bubble wrap(small bubbles preferably)
light blue paint
construction paper
cotton balls for clouds
Optional:other colored paints for adding scenery

Spread out a section of bubble wrap with slightly over half of the bubbles popped. Cover the bubbles with a thin coat of light blue paint. Place a piece of light blue construction paper over the bubbles and rub gently. Remove paper and let dry. Spread some cotton balls out a bit and glue on paper for clouds.

spring crafts for kids at www.create-kids-crafts.com Spring Windsock

Art and Craft Supplies Needed:

3 different colors of craft foam sheets
1 green craft foam sheet
hole punch
string
colored ribbon of your choice
scissors
glue

1. Draw and cut out flowers from 2 of the colored foam sheets. Draw and cut out leaf shapes from the green foam sheet.
2. With the 3rd colored foam sheet, use a hole punch and punch holes approximately 1 inch apart down the length of both short edges of the foam sheet. With the string, weave together the short edges of the foam sheet through the holes to form a tube. Punch 2 holes; one on either side of the top of the tube and attach a ribbon to hang up the windsock.
3. Glue on the foam flowers and green foam leaves.
4. Punch holes along the bottom edge of the tube and tie on colored ribbons through the holes.
